Lawyers As Changemakers
About
"The book describes and illustrates emerging integrative approaches such as earth jurisprudence, sharing law, conscious (values-based) contracts, purposeful estate planning, and many others. It provides a context for many other movements in law, from mindfulness meditation to alternative billing practices, and explores the tools of systems change, including many theories and approaches."--
